The bird of the day. This species is tough to find in our inland counties but this one didn't read the field guide and the Shands Pier seems to attract weird coastal species like this one. I didn't see it at first while scanning terns and then it walked across the pier from left to right and proceeded to sit between to of the bridge uprights facing into the wind. I snapped a couple poor photos, hindered by distance and heat shimmer. Unfortunately, Steve Raduns, who arrived moments after I spotted the bird, only got to see its rump sticking out from the edge of the wooden posts, but it was visible in the scope. It was a relatively large grayish shorebird standing on long grey legs and with a long, straight, heavy grey bill. Poor photos attached.
